Run Bonsai Language Models Locally
PrismML-Eng/Bonsai-demo · Shell
Bonsai-demo provides scripts and documentation for running PrismML's Bonsai language models locally across Mac, Linux, Windows, and CPU-only setups. It supports Metal, CUDA, Vulkan, and ROCm backends, with links to Bonsai 27B, 1-bit Bonsai, and Ternary-Bonsai model releases and whitepapers. The repo targets users who want to test compact or quantized LLMs on local hardware.

Run Bonsai models on local hardware
Bonsai-demo packages the setup path for PrismML's Bonsai model family, including Bonsai 27B, 1-bit Bonsai, and Ternary-Bonsai.
What it supports
The repo focuses on local inference across common environments: Mac with Metal, Linux or Windows with CUDA, Vulkan, or ROCm, and CPU-only machines.
Why it matters
It gives developers a direct way to test quantized Bonsai models without relying on a hosted API. The linked model collections and whitepapers also make it easier to compare the 27B, 1-bit, and ternary variants.
